Press the lock button on the fob once - everythings locked, and internal sensors are activated.
Press the lock button a second time (within 3 secs of the first press) - everything stays locked, but internal sensors are not activated.
At least I assume that this is correct, it's what I do when I leave the dogs in the car - and so far (touch wood !) they've not set the alarm off in the middle of the night ! Jim
